4.12.4
PEMU/REMU
Programming
Overview
The following
programming
parameters
may be
specified for the PEMU/REMU:
Program
03-Specify
Code
13 for slots that will
support PEMUs and make sure RRCS is enabled
for
DTMF operation.
Note:
If there are no options for any of the cabinet
PCBs:
Program
03 can be skipped,
and
Program 91 can be run instead.
Program
04-Specifies
[PDNs].
These are also the
numbers that must be received by incoming tie lines to
route calls to the proper telephones
(see Program
17,
LED 05).
Program
IO-I-Allows
or
denies
Two-line
Conference.

Program
15-Assigns
tandem
connections
and Dial
Pulse option to tie lines.
Program
17
n
Assigns
Immediate
or Wink start to REMU tie
lines.
IMPORTANT!
Also used to turn on tie line Dial tone return.
Note:
When a PEMU
or REMU
is installed
in a
system, it automatically
assumes the next four
consecutive
CO line and station port numbers.
n
Assigns tie/DID
lines to route per DNIS and ANI
options (Program 71 and 72) or [PDNs]
(Program
04).
Program
30-Disables
RRCS
for
Dial
pulse
operation.
Program
71 (1 - 5)-Tie/DID
DNIS assignments.
I
Program
*71 - *73-DH/tie/DID
to [DN]
ringing
assignments.
